Candiceelaine, there are 2 sides to quitting. First there is overcoming nicotine addiction by purging your body of nicotine. Withdrawal symptoms are usually gone by 2 weeks from the last "dose" of nicotine. Secondly, & for me, the more difficult facet is breaking the habit. We have spent years conditioning our brain to react in certain situations to reach for a cigarette. When we're celebrating, when we're sad, when we're anxious, when we're bored, after a meal, after completion of a task. We have convinced our subconscious that smoking somehow makes a difference. So, ......while you we're vaping, you were still going through the motions of smoking & may account for your feeling like it has only been 8 days. It gets better...hang in there.
